Saaf Bazar | Designing Meaning into Clean Energy

Context

Saaf Bazar was conceived as a solar-focused marketplace during a period of growing renewable energy adoption. The challenge was to create a brand identity that communicated sustainability, trust, and modernity while remaining culturally rooted and emotionally resonant.
The identity needed to stand apart in a technically crowded industry and feel both responsible and aspirational.

Strategic Foundation

The name “Saaf” means clean, but it carries deeper cultural weight through the phrase صفائی نصف ایمان ہے, which translates to “Cleanliness is half of faith.” This idea became the philosophical backbone of the brand.
The goal was to visually express not only environmental cleanliness, but moral responsibility and intentional living. The identity had to reflect balance between action and accountability, progress and preservation.
The brand was designed to represent:
Clean energy and environmental stewardship
Cultural authenticity
Harmony and balance
Long-term responsibility

Concept Development

The circular logo mark was built around the idea of harmony in duality. Its swirling structure subtly represents balance between opposing forces such as consumption and conservation. The intentional variation in visual weight symbolizes responsibility on one side and renewal on the other.
Rather than striving for rigid symmetry, the construction incorporates subtle visual imbalance to create a more organic and human presence. This approach makes the identity feel thoughtful rather than mechanical.
Cultural elements were integrated carefully, allowing the design to remain globally scalable while preserving local identity.

Visual System

The typography balances bold structural presence with clean functional clarity. The color palette combines deep greens and blues to signal sustainability and trust, alongside grounded earth tones that reflect environmental connection.
Logo variations and applications were designed for flexibility across digital and physical touchpoints without compromising consistency.

Outcome

The final identity positioned Saaf Bazar as more than a solar marketplace. It framed the brand as a responsible movement rooted in cultural meaning and environmental integrity.
The design was approved on the first presentation with no revisions requested, reflecting strong alignment between strategic intent and visual execution.
